“In the oil and gas sector, the term ‘downstream’ generally refers to the facilities responsible for removing impurities and converting oil and gas raw materials into useful products . Critical...
“In the oil and gas sector, the term ‘downstream’ generally refers to the facilities responsible for removing impurities and converting oil and gas raw materials into useful products . Critical...